What Are Local Business Directories?
Local business directories are online platforms that list businesses based on their location and industry. Examples include Google My Business, Yelp, Bing Places, and industry-specific directories. They serve as digital yellow pages, helping potential clients find local services quickly and easily.
Benefits of Using Business Directories for Realtors
- Increased Visibility: Your profile appears in local searches, making it easier for clients to find you.
- Improved SEO: Listings with accurate information and keywords boost your search engine rankings.
- Enhanced Credibility: Positive reviews and consistent NAP (Name, Address, Phone Number) information build trust.
- Higher Website Traffic: Directories often link to your website, driving more visitors.
How to Optimize Your Directory Listings
To maximize the benefits, ensure your listings are complete and accurate. Include essential information such as your contact details, office hours, and professional photos. Use relevant keywords in your business description to improve search visibility. Encourage satisfied clients to leave positive reviews, as they influence your ranking and reputation.
Best Practices for Realtors
- Regularly update your profile to reflect new listings or services.
- Respond promptly to reviews, thanking clients and addressing concerns.
- Maintain consistency in your NAP details across all directories.
- Monitor your listings’ performance and adjust your strategy accordingly.
